HLS 111ES-16 ORIGINAL Page 1 of 3 First Extraordinary Session, 2011 HOUSE CONCURRENT RESOLUTI ON NO. 2 BY REPRESENTATIVE PUGH SPECIAL DAY/WEEK/MONTH: Recognizes Monday, April 4, 2011, as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ival Day A CONCURRENT RESOLUTI ON1 To recognize Monday, April 4, 2011, as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ival Day.2 WHEREAS, it is appropriate to commend the organizers and volunteers of the3 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ival and to recognize Monday, April 4, 2011, as Ponchatoula4 Strawberry Festival Day; and5 WHEREAS, the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ival Board was organized in 1971, and6 the first festival was held in April of 1972; and7 WHEREAS, the first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ival was cosponsored by the8 Ponchatoula Jaycees and the Ponchatoula Chamber of Commerce, and both organizations9 provided three members to serve on the festival board; and10 WHEREAS, the planning committee and many other interested volunteers worked11 diligently for months planning the first festival, which was located on the first block of North12 Sixth Street and only had eleven booths; and13 WHEREAS, the first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ival was a two-day event that14 started off with a baseball game between Southeastern Louisiana University and Wisconsin15 State, and later that day, the first annual parade made its way through Ponchatoula with16 sixty-five units from all over the state; and17 WHEREAS, estimated attendance for the weekend of the first Ponchatoula18 Strawberry Festival was fifteen thousand; and19 WHEREAS, the first royalty court of the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ival consisted20 of Queen Sissy Dufreche, King Fred Beachamp, and Princess Sandy Smith, and the queen21 HLS 111ES-16 ORIGINAL HCR NO. 2 Page 2 of 3 and her court made several appearances on television and radio stations throughout the state1 to publicize the festival; and2 WHEREAS, during his first term in office, Governor Edwin Edwards proclaimed3 April as Strawberry Festival Month; and4 WHEREAS, from the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ival's humble beginning, it has5 evolved into a Louisiana celebration second only to Mardi Gras in its magnitude; and6 WHEREAS, today, the annual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ival is organized by the7 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ival Board, Inc., which is comprised of a chairperson,8 chairperson-elect, treasurer, secretary, parliamentarian, and other essential positions; and9 WHEREAS, decisions of the festival board are the responsibility of the sixteen10 voting board members who represent various organizations, including the Ponchatoula11 Chamber of Commerce, the Ponchatoula Jaycees, the Ponchatoula Rotary Club, the12 Ponchatoula Kiwanis, the Knights of Columbus, Ponchatoula Youth Baseball, the Champ13 Cooper School, and the Ponchatoula Lions Club; and14 WHEREAS, the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ival Board is a proud member of15 Louisiana Association of Fairs and Festivals; and16 WHEREAS, today, the official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ival grounds include17 Memorial Park and the first two blocks of North Sixth Street; and18 WHEREAS, the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ival continually draws a huge crowd19 that strolls through America's Antique City and watches one of the biggest parades in south20 Louisiana; and21 WHEREAS, for more than thirty years, the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ival has22 provided a venue as a fundraiser for nonprofit and charitable organizations, and the festival23 prides itself as being one of the only festivals in which nonprofit organizations are the only24 vendors on the official festival grounds; and25 WHEREAS, the 2011 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ival is being held on April 8,26 2011, through April 10, 2011, in Ponchatoula, Louisiana; and27 WHEREAS, the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ival and its organizers and volunteers28 merit a sincere measure of commendation for their contributions to the culture and economy29 of the state of Louisiana.30 HLS 111ES-16 ORIGINAL HCR NO. 2 Page 3 of 3 TH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ED that the Legislature of Louisiana does hereby1 recognize Monday, April 4, 2011, as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ival Day and does hereby2 celebrate the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ival as an integral part of the culture and history3 of the city of Ponchatoula and the state of Louisiana.4 B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that a suitable copy of this Resolution be transmitted5 to the Ponchatoula Strawberry Festival Board, Inc.6 DIGEST The digest printed below was prepared by House Legislative Services.
